158/*
159 * BEGIN iwlwifi/mvm/phy-ctxt.c
160 */
161
162/*
163 * Construct the generic fields of the PHY context command
164 */
165static void
166iwm_phy_ctxt_cmd_hdr(struct iwm_softc *sc, struct iwm_phy_ctxt *ctxt,
167	struct iwm_phy_context_cmd *cmd, uint32_t action, uint32_t apply_time)
168{
169	memset(cmd, 0, sizeof(struct iwm_phy_context_cmd));
170
171	IWM_DPRINTF(sc, IWM_DEBUG_RESET | IWM_DEBUG_CMD,
172	    "%s: id=%d, colour=%d, action=%d, apply_time=%d\n",
173	    __func__,
174	    ctxt->id,
175	    ctxt->color,
176	    action,
177	    apply_time);
178
179	cmd->id_and_color = htole32(IWM_FW_CMD_ID_AND_COLOR(ctxt->id,
180	    ctxt->color));
181	cmd->action = htole32(action);
182	cmd->apply_time = htole32(apply_time);
183}
184
185/*
186 * Add the phy configuration to the PHY context command
187 */
188static void
189iwm_phy_ctxt_cmd_data(struct iwm_softc *sc,
190	struct iwm_phy_context_cmd *cmd, struct ieee80211_channel *chan,
191	uint8_t chains_static, uint8_t chains_dynamic)
192{
193	struct ieee80211com *ic = &sc->sc_ic;
194	uint8_t active_cnt, idle_cnt;
195
196	IWM_DPRINTF(sc, IWM_DEBUG_RESET | IWM_DEBUG_CMD,
197	    "%s: 2ghz=%d, channel=%d, chains static=0x%x, dynamic=0x%x, "
198	    "rx_ant=0x%x, tx_ant=0x%x\n",
199	    __func__,
200	    !! IEEE80211_IS_CHAN_2GHZ(chan),
201	    ieee80211_chan2ieee(ic, chan),
202	    chains_static,
203	    chains_dynamic,
204	    iwm_get_valid_rx_ant(sc),
205	    iwm_get_valid_tx_ant(sc));
206
207
208	cmd->ci.band = IEEE80211_IS_CHAN_2GHZ(chan) ?
209	    IWM_PHY_BAND_24 : IWM_PHY_BAND_5;
210
211	cmd->ci.channel = ieee80211_chan2ieee(ic, chan);
212	cmd->ci.width = IWM_PHY_VHT_CHANNEL_MODE20;
213	cmd->ci.ctrl_pos = IWM_PHY_VHT_CTRL_POS_1_BELOW;
214
215	/* Set rx the chains */
216	idle_cnt = chains_static;
217	active_cnt = chains_dynamic;
218
219	/* In scenarios where we only ever use a single-stream rates,
220	 * i.e. legacy 11b/g/a associations, single-stream APs or even
221	 * static SMPS, enable both chains to get diversity, improving
222	 * the case where we're far enough from the AP that attenuation
223	 * between the two antennas is sufficiently different to impact
224	 * performance.
225	 */
226	if (active_cnt == 1 && iwm_rx_diversity_allowed(sc)) {
227		idle_cnt = 2;
228		active_cnt = 2;
229	}
230
231	cmd->rxchain_info = htole32(iwm_get_valid_rx_ant(sc) <<
232					IWM_PHY_RX_CHAIN_VALID_POS);
233	cmd->rxchain_info |= htole32(idle_cnt << IWM_PHY_RX_CHAIN_CNT_POS);
234	cmd->rxchain_info |= htole32(active_cnt <<
235	    IWM_PHY_RX_CHAIN_MIMO_CNT_POS);
236
237	cmd->txchain_info = htole32(iwm_get_valid_tx_ant(sc));
238}
239
240/*
241 * Send a command
242 * only if something in the configuration changed: in case that this is the
243 * first time that the phy configuration is applied or in case that the phy
244 * configuration changed from the previous apply.
245 */
246static int
247iwm_phy_ctxt_apply(struct iwm_softc *sc,
248	struct iwm_phy_ctxt *ctxt,
249	uint8_t chains_static, uint8_t chains_dynamic,
250	uint32_t action, uint32_t apply_time)
251{
252	struct iwm_phy_context_cmd cmd;
253	int ret;
254
255	IWM_DPRINTF(sc, IWM_DEBUG_RESET | IWM_DEBUG_CMD,
256	    "%s: called; channel=%p\n",
257	    __func__,
258	    ctxt->channel);
259
260	/* Set the command header fields */
261	iwm_phy_ctxt_cmd_hdr(sc, ctxt, &cmd, action, apply_time);
262
263	/* Set the command data */
264	iwm_phy_ctxt_cmd_data(sc, &cmd, ctxt->channel,
265	    chains_static, chains_dynamic);
266
267	ret = iwm_send_cmd_pdu(sc, IWM_PHY_CONTEXT_CMD, IWM_CMD_SYNC,
268	    sizeof(struct iwm_phy_context_cmd), &cmd);
269	if (ret) {
270		device_printf(sc->sc_dev,
271		    "PHY ctxt cmd error. ret=%d\n", ret);
272	}
273	return ret;
274}
275
276/*
277 * Send a command to add a PHY context based on the current HW configuration.
278 */
279int
280iwm_phy_ctxt_add(struct iwm_softc *sc, struct iwm_phy_ctxt *ctxt,
281	struct ieee80211_channel *chan,
282	uint8_t chains_static, uint8_t chains_dynamic)
283{
284	ctxt->channel = chan;
285
286	IWM_DPRINTF(sc, IWM_DEBUG_RESET | IWM_DEBUG_CMD,
287	    "%s: called; channel=%d\n",
288	    __func__,
289	    ieee80211_chan2ieee(&sc->sc_ic, chan));
290
291	return iwm_phy_ctxt_apply(sc, ctxt,
292	    chains_static, chains_dynamic, IWM_FW_CTXT_ACTION_ADD, 0);
293}
294
295/*
296 * Send a command to modify the PHY context based on the current HW
297 * configuration. Note that the function does not check that the configuration
298 * changed.
299 */
300int
301iwm_phy_ctxt_changed(struct iwm_softc *sc,
302	struct iwm_phy_ctxt *ctxt, struct ieee80211_channel *chan,
303	uint8_t chains_static, uint8_t chains_dynamic)
304{
305	ctxt->channel = chan;
306
307	IWM_DPRINTF(sc, IWM_DEBUG_RESET | IWM_DEBUG_CMD,
308	    "%s: called; channel=%d\n",
309	    __func__,
310	    ieee80211_chan2ieee(&sc->sc_ic, chan));
311
312	return iwm_phy_ctxt_apply(sc, ctxt,
313	    chains_static, chains_dynamic, IWM_FW_CTXT_ACTION_MODIFY, 0);
314}
315
316/*
317 * END iwlwifi/mvm/phy-ctxt.c
318 */
